What exactly is AEO, and why does my business need it?

AEO stands for Answer Engine Optimization. While traditional SEO helps you show up in a list of links, AEO ensures that AI agents (like Gemini, ChatGPT, and Perplexity) can parse your site's data to provide direct answers about your business. I build your "knowledge asset" so that when a neighbor asks their phone for a local recommendation, your business is the top answer.

What does "semantic" web design mean, and why should I care?

Think of it like a library: if every book on the shelf had a blank white spine, you'd never find what you need. Semantic HTML uses code that actually describes what the content is (like "this is an article" or "this is a main navigation") rather than just how it looks.

This is vital for two reasons: Accessibility (ensuring neighbors using screen readers can navigate your site) and AEO/SEO (helping AI agents and search engines understand exactly what your business offers). Most builders produce "code soup"—I build structured data.
